Reverse description Central device consists of a large armillary sphere, rendered with prominent parallel latitude bands and diagonal meridian bands, positioned over and in front of the arms of the Order of Christ cross, whose four extremities extend to the edges of the field. The armillary sphere, a symbol of Portuguese maritime exploration, dominates the design and partially obscures the underlying cross. The circumferential Latin legend SVBQ. SIGN. NATA. STAB. encircles the device, reading 'Born under a steady sign,' a reference to the Order of Christ. The legend is separated by dot stops and set within a toothed or beaded border.
